摘要: Surface coatings including microparticles immobilized in a matrix of polymeric material on a substrate are described. The microparticles can also include an agent which can be useful for various applications, such as medical applications.This invention relates to the field of surface coatings for use in various applications. More particularly, the invention relates to surface coating useful for drug delivery, imaging and other uses of microparticles immobilized via a polymeric matrix.

摘要: Arrays including microparticles having probe and marker moieties are used for the detection of a target in a sample. Microparticles are randomly immobilized on at least a portion of a substrate. A detection scheme is performed to detect the marker associated with the microparticle and the identity of the probe, and any target bound to the probe.

摘要: A thermally-reactive polymer that forms a polymer-coupled reactive species upon heating is described and useful for forming coated surfaces. The polymer-coated surface has improved lubricity and passivity. A thermally-reactive quaternary amine-containing polymer was produced that provides passivity and anti-microbial activity.

摘要: A surface coating composition for providing a self-assembling monolayer, in stable form, on a material surface or at a suitable interface, as well as a method of preparing such a composition and a method of using such a composition to coat a surface, such as the surface of an implantable medical device, in order to provide the surface with desirable properties. The method provides the covalent attachment of a SAM to a surface in a manner that substantially retains or improves the characteristics and/or performance of both the SAM and the surface itself. Covalent attachment is accomplished by the use of one or more latent reactive groups, e.g., provided by either the surface and/or by the SAM-forming molecules themselves.
